How Do American Standard Heat Pumps Work?
The operation of American Standard heat pumps is based on a simple yet effective principle: the refrigeration cycle. This cycle consists of four main components—evaporator, compressor, condenser, and expansion valve—which work together to transfer heat.
During winter, the heat pump extracts heat from the outside air, even in cold conditions, and transfers it inside. The refrigerant, a substance that changes state from liquid to gas and back, absorbs heat from the outdoor air in the evaporator. This gas is then compressed, elevating its temperature and pressure, before moving to the condenser inside the home, where it releases heat. In summer, the process can be reversed to provide cooling, making it a versatile year-round solution.

Choosing the Right American Standard Heat Pump
Factors to Consider Before Purchase
Selecting the appropriate American Standard heat pump goes beyond brand preference. It requires careful consideration of several critical factors:
- Size: The heat pump must be appropriately sized for your home. A unit that is too small will struggle to provide adequate heating or cooling, while an oversized system can lead to inefficiency and increased wear.
- Climate: Different heat pumps are designed for varied climates. Consider local temperature ranges and select a model that performs well under your specific conditions.
- Energy Source: Determine whether you prefer air-source, ground-source, or water-source heat pumps based on availability and environmental factors.
Comparing Different Models
Once you understand your requirements, it’s time to explore the various American Standard heat pump models. Comparison should be based on factors such as:
- Efficiency Ratings: Look for the SEER and Heating Seasonal Performance Factor (HSPF) ratings to gauge energy efficiency.
- Warranty and Services: Assess the warranty terms and the availability of professional service in your area. A longer warranty often indicates a higher quality product.
- User Reviews: Research customer feedback and expert reviews to understand the performance and reliability of different models.
Installation Requirements for American Standard Heat Pumps
Installing an American Standard heat pump requires professional assistance to ensure optimal operation and efficiency. Key considerations include:
- Location: The outdoor unit needs adequate airflow and should be placed away from barriers like walls or fences.
- Electrical Needs: Ensure your home has the right electrical connections and capacity to support the heat pump.
- Ductwork: If upgrading from traditional heating, assess whether existing ductwork needs modifications for compatibility with the heat pump.
Maintenance Tips for American Standard Heat Pumps
Routine Maintenance Checklist
To ensure the longevity and efficiency of your American Standard heat pump, it is essential to adhere to a regular maintenance schedule. Key maintenance tasks include:
- Cleaning or replacing air filters every 1-3 months.
- Inspecting and cleaning the outdoor unit to remove debris.
- Checking refrigerant levels and ensuring there are no leaks.
- Scheduling annual professional servicing for thorough inspections and performance checks.
Signs Your American Standard Heat Pump Needs Repair
Being vigilant about your heat pump’s performance can help you catch problems early. Signs that your American Standard heat pump may need repair include:
- Inconsistent heating or cooling.
- Strange noises or vibrations during operation.
- Unexplained increases in energy bills.
- Visible frost on the outdoor unit in warmer weather.
Professional Service vs. DIY Maintenance
While many maintenance tasks can be performed by homeowners—like changing filters and cleaning outdoor units—certain repairs and detailed inspections should be left to professionals. Trained technicians can diagnose issues that are not apparent and have the tools necessary to perform repairs safely, ensuring your heat pump operates effectively and efficiently.
